I Finally Have A New Phone

This is probably the only place I'll ever call it a Scoblephone because in "the real world", nobody would know what I'm talking about. For them, it is the Audiovox SMT 5600. I resisted the phone for months because it isn't a flip phone and that is usually a showstopper for me. I'm definitely not happy about that but there just isn't a good MS Mobile flip phone. I waited months for the Motorola MPx 220 and that phone turned out to be the worst phone I've ever had the displeasure of dealing with. Even after 2 or 3 recalls, the phone is still a piece of junk. But even if it did work, it still falls behind the 5600 in pretty much every category (including screensize) except for the fact that the Motorola is a flip.

So far, the phone is great. I'm looking forward to finally getting to build some toys in VS.NET and play with them on the phone instead of being stuck in that emulator.

If you're in the market for a new phone, Cingular has the 5600 for $250 with 2-year contract (online only, I haven't found any stores that have these yet). If you don't want/need a smartphone, they have the silver Motorola RAZR for $199.
